Recently, Apple announced a significant update for its devices, including iPhone, iPad, and Mac, with the release of security updates 26.5.2. While it appears that no actively exploited vulnerabilities have been patched, the installation of these updates is strongly advised to ensure device security.

Nearly 40 Vulnerabilities Addressed per Platform

The latest updates resolve approximately 40 registered vulnerabilities in the CVE system for each platform. These issues primarily affect the system kernel and Apple’s browser engine, WebKit. Additionally, a separate update for the Safari browser has been released, bringing it to version 26.5.2.

Apple provides a detailed list of all corrections in its security updates and measures for various operating systems. As is customary, the German translation will arrive later, so we link to the English version for timely access.

Focusing on Kernel and WebKit

Several critical vulnerabilities were identified, which could have allowed applications to access kernel memory or read sensitive information from it. Other vulnerabilities could lead to memory corruption or unexpected system crashes.

In the WebKit browser engine, Apple has fixed flaws that could allow maliciously crafted websites to read sensitive user data or otherwise capture information. Additional vulnerabilities could have enabled attackers to bypass browser sandbox protections, process content from secure areas, or secretly acquire clipboard data. Numerous memory-related issues were also resolved to prevent crashes in Safari or individual processes.

AI Assists in Bug Discovery

Interestingly, several of the reported vulnerabilities were discovered using AI tools such as OpenAI’s Codex Security and Anthropic’s Claude. This advancement highlights the growing role of artificial intelligence in enhancing cybersecurity efforts.
